Nestled on the Lehigh valley, Best Western Allentown Inn & Suites is a stylish vacation hotel and high-tech business center with amenity rich rooms and suites, meeting facilities and exciting Pennsylv...
Author: bwallentowninnsuites
Details, Comments 0, Reviews 0